This league player produced some sickening collisions at the weekend

Luke Page was in imposing form for the Mount Pritchard Mounties against the Sea Eagles.

RUGBY LEAGUE CAN be a brutal sport at times, much like union, and Luke Page took the opportunity to remind us of exactly that over the weekend.

Playing for the Mouth Pritchard Mounties in a NSW Cup clash with the Manly-Warringah Sea Eagles, Page produced some sickening collisions with his powerful running game.

The Sea Eagles’ Dylan Kelly [number 12] came off particularly badly after attempting to halt Page in full flight.

The Mounties prop uses his forearm almost like the bullbar on a car and it will be interesting to watch him if and when he steps up to NRL level with the Canberra Raiders, to whom he is contracted.
